Default Google is bogged down in red tape

Former worker warns company is slowly ceasing to function

Ex-Google employee. Praveen Seshadri as warned that the company is getting so bogged down in bureaucratic processes that it can’t do anything without orders – signed in triplicate, sent in, sent back, queried, lost, found, subjected to public inquiry, lost again, and finally buried in soft peat for three months and recycled as firelighters.

Seshadri recently quit and detailed the problems he saw during his time at the company. Seshadri says Google is "trapped in a maze of approvals, launch processes, legal reviews, performance reviews, exec reviews," and other bureaucratic processes, and while the employees are capable, they "get very little done quarter over quarter, year over year."
